As you sit and reflect on your family, you can't help but acknowledge the many differences that have caused so much turmoil. There have been days when you all could barely look at each other, let alone hold a conversation. Arguments and disagreements have been your constant companions. But it doesn't have to be this way. So many families are destroyed because they lack a foundation of faith. In the absence of faith, we are easily overtaken by our egos and personal opinions. It's only natural that we have differing opinions. We are different people with unique experiences and perspectives. But if we place our faith in God, we can learn to see each other in a new light. We can find ways to love and support one another despite our differences. And that love can be transformative. It can change us and heal our broken relationships. The Bible tells the story of a miracle that Jesus performed at a wedding feast. He turned water into wine, a symbol of transformation and renewal. Just as He turned ordinary water into extraordinary wine, He can also transform our lives and our relationships. It won't be easy. There will be moments of doubt and uncertainty. But if we have faith and trust in God, He can bring salvation to our family. We can learn to forgive and reconcile. We can embrace our differences and find unity in our faith.So let us not give up on our families. Let us remember that God is with us every step of the way. He can bring us together and make our relationships stronger than ever before. With faith, we can turn our household from ordinary water into a beautiful, transformative wine.
